leadership committees
Our Council is supported by five committees that bring all aspects of our program to life throughout the year. Please contact karen@girlsontherunkazoo.org if you have an interest in serving on a planning committee.
gotr operations:
- Oversees and coordinates the implementation of the GOTR program.
- Reviews curriculum and prepares materials, copies and supplies for coach’s kit assembly.
- Distributes snacks, supplies, shoes and coach’s kits.
- Recruits, interviews, and trains GOTR coaches.
- Maintains regular communication with coaches.
- Leads the data entry/registration process for each participant.
- Coordinates practice site visits during program.
- Meets once per month October through March - usually in the evening.

new balance girls on the run 5k:
- Organizes a festive 5K run/walk for GOTR with over 5,000 attendees.
- Coordinates event set-up/tear-down.
- Recruits, organizes and schedules event volunteers.
- Solicits food/beverage and equipment donations and coordinates delivery.
- Works closely with the City/Township police to coordinate traffic and parking.
- Designs the course, water stations, communicates with the neighborhood.
- Coordinates t-shirts, medallions and prizes for girls.
- Communicates with coaches about the 5k celebration event.
- Registers community members who pay to run with the girls.
- Meets January through May, 1-2 times per week usually during the evening
